Toledo Bend Offers It All

Posted by BigBassJB on October 29th, 2007

My name is Jim Binns and I live on one of the most beautiful lakes in our state .. Toledo Bend.

Toledo Bend Reservoir is located on the Sabine River and shares its water with both Texas and Louisiana. The lake was constructed by the Sabine River Authority of Texas, and the Sabine River Authority of Louisiana, primarily for the purposes of water supply, hydroelectric power generation, and recreation. Toledo Bend is the largest man made body of water in the south and the fifth largest in surface acres in the United States. You can take a long boat ride on this lake because it extends for about 65 miles and has 1,200 miles of pristine and scenic shoreline.

When you come to Toledo Bend expect to have fun. Boating, swimming, camping, hunting, birding and camping are available along with some of the best fishing in the state. Toledo Bend offers a smorgasbord of fishing for species such as catfish, crappie, white and yellow bass, bream, striped bass and of course the always popular black bass. Better spool new line on your reels and sharpen those hooks because this lake has bass swimming in its waters that can pull the scales down past the 15-pound mark. Family outings can really be great fun when everyone is catching palm-size panfish and yellow bass. If you are new to the lake you can even book an excellent guided fishing trip through one of the local marinas.

This area is made up of rolling hills with an abundance of majestic pine trees that stretch up into the heavens. Residential homes range from weekend cottages to luxurious retirement estates that offer a calm and peaceful serenity from the fast-paced hustle and bustle of the metropolitan life. Peaceful coves and an abundance of plants and flowers offer a beauty that will take your breath away.

Are you tired of that harsh winter weather with all of its snow and ice? Well the Toledo Bend area offers a mild climate and on a number of occasions I have been fishing in a T-shirt and shorts during the month of January. My family and I visited Toledo Bend for a number of years and now my wife and I are retirees that enjoy the abundance the lake offers on a daily basis. Once you experience the beauty of Toledo Bend it’s hard not to return.
